Nassar and Kota Srinivasa Rao appeared together in 22 Telugu films between 2000 and 2025. Their highest-rated collaboration was Athadu (2005 — 7.7/10). Films span Vamsi (2000) through Hari Hara Veera Mallu: Part 1 – Sword vs Spirit (2025).
